Automated sub-meter billing for Kenyan landlords

A billing platform that turns a photo of a shared electricity meter into an accurate, itemized WhatsApp invoice — using Claude Vision to read meters and parse KPLC rates.

The challenge

Landlords with shared electricity meters in Kenya were splitting bills by hand — reading sub-meters, guessing at KPLC's tiered rates, and fielding disputes from tenants who didn't trust the math.

What we built

  • A Next.js web app where caretakers photograph sub-meters; Claude Vision extracts the reading automatically.
  • A rate-parsing pipeline that reads true KPLC tariffs directly from official SMS bills, instead of relying on stale published rate cards.
  • Automatic itemized invoice delivery to tenants over WhatsApp, showing usage, rate, and charge breakdown.
  • A free tier for single-property landlords and custom pricing for multi-property portfolios.

The outcome

Stimafy is in beta across Nairobi, Mombasa, and Kisumu, replacing manual spreadsheet billing with a photo-in, invoice-out workflow — reported at ~98% meter-reading accuracy.
